About This Coffee

This coffee is a Geisha variety from Finca El Paraiso in Piendamó, Cauca, Colombia. Produced by Diego Samuel Bermúdez Tapia at 1,960 meters altitude, the beans undergo Washed Thermal Shock processing. The thermal shock method involves controlled fermentation and temperature treatment during washing. This is a competition-grade coffee from the Archers Coffee competition series.

Archers

Six friends from different professional backgrounds founded Archers in 2018 in Sharjah, driven by a shared conviction that the UAE specialty coffee scene needed better education, access to quality green coffee, and higher sourcing standards. The company operates as both a green coffee trader and a roastery, sourcing from 13 origin countries with a strict minimum cup score of 85. Among the founding team are multiple licensed CQI Q Graders, including co founder and green buyer Frederick Bejo, and the facility holds dual certification as an SCA and CQI training campus. The roasting philosophy centers on minimal intervention, letting the terroir and processing speak rather than imposing a house style. David Disuanco, part of the Archers team, won the 2021 UAE National Brewers Cup and went on to represent the country at the World Brewers Cup, where the UAE placed in the top ten for the first time.
